If there is one setting that defines Gujarati romance, it is Navratri. The nine nights of Garba provide a cinematic backdrop for romantic storylines. The rhythmic clapping, the swirling of colorful Chaniya Cholis and Kediyus , and the shared eye contact across a crowded circle have sparked countless real-life and fictional love stories. Navratri is often portrayed as the season of "falling in love at first sight," where the energy of the dance allows for a socially acceptable way for young men and women to interact and build chemistry. Malela Jeev tells the tragic love story of , a young man from the Patel caste, and Jivi , a woman from the Valand (barber) caste. Set in Ahmedabad, the novel follows the troubles they face as their love defies rigid caste boundaries.
